Action item: map-tile prefetcher cache bound (Wayfern incident)

Owner: platform team. The Wayfern prefetcher filled disk on three edge nodes, degrading map loads for two hours. Fix: enforce a hard cache ceiling and evict by region age. Support should flag any repeat reports of blank tiles as possible recurrence. Status updates and the rollout schedule are tracked on the page below.

wiki page, bageg-kahif: https://gitlab.qorvellabs.internal/view/spaces/job/2a5e7e5f1a93

## Onboarding — Markdown Pipeline (Inkmere)

Inkmere docs render through a three-stage pipeline: parse, sanitize, emit. Releases rebuild all templates; never hot-patch emitted HTML. Broken renders usually mean a sanitizer rule change — check the rules diff first. The render cluster only accepts builds from the release channel, and every build artifact must be signed before upload. Sign artifacts with the deploy key below.

release key, hafop-tajef: bky13_s2vaFVNJTHfBL

FABRICANT_SEED controls determinism; FABRICANT_LOCALE sets name and address generation (all values are synthetic, never sampled from production). FABRICANT_MODE toggles between inline generation and the shared fixture cache hosted on the Brindle cluster. For security review purposes, note that the only sensitive value in this setup is the credential used to write to the shared fixture cache; everything else is non-secret tuning. That credential is set in the env file on the following line:

env line for fafof-fahag: LEDGER_TOKEN5=f8790

## Fernwick Partner SFTP Drop

Hey on-call — this page covers the Brindle Logistics SFTP drop that feeds nightly manifests into Fernwick. Files land around 02:30 and the ingest job polls every ten minutes. If nothing arrives by 04:00, you'll get paged; usually it's the partner's side, so check the drop directory first before escalating. Staging uses a mirrored drop with fake manifests, so test there freely. The connection settings for the production drop are as follows.

service settings:
PRAIX_LOG_LEVEL=error
PRAIX_METRICS_HOST=metrics.praix.qorvelcorp.corp
PRAIX_POOL_SIZE=16